Samaritans Purse is seeking a Regional Director to join our team working remotely, based in or around Houston, TX. You can be a part of a highly professional Donor Ministries team. As a Regional Director
, you will build strategic, long-term partnerships with 250+ current and prospective major donors within a region of the United States on behalf of Samaritans Purse. You will steward partners giving gifts of $20k and above annually and manage an average portfolio of $10M annually. You will focus on sharing what God is doing through the ministry and intentionally develop strategic relationships that invite people into deep and meaningful partnership to facilitate the ongoing funding of Samaritans Purse programs.
